WebJun 23, 2024 · Scarlet Tanager. Several red birds look like cardinals at a glance. Scarlet tanagers have solid red heads and bodies with black wings and tail feathers. These migrating birds tend to stay high in the treetops. Check out 4 vibrant tanager species you should to know . Courtesy Bill Palmer. WebMar 22, 2024 · Types of Gray Birds in North America. 1. Dark-eyed Junco. Sparrows, known as dark-eyed Juncos, may have a variety of various colors depending on where they live. In the east, they often have a slate-gray appearance, but in the west, they might be white, black, or brown.
